MTN Zambia  and UBA Zambia  have officially joined forces to launch the Mastercard Virtual Card, a milestone that signals a major shift in the country’s financial landscape. This collaboration, recently highlighted by UBA Zambia’s Country Head of Digital Banking Sales, David Fundanga, serves as a strategic bridge between mobile money convenience and global banking security. By integrating UBA’s robust banking infrastructure with MTN’s massive subscriber base, the partnership effectively turns every mobile phone into a globally recognized payment tool.

For the average Zambian, this initiative removes the long-standing hurdles of traditional banking, such as the need for physical paperwork or a high-balance account to obtain a credit card. The virtual card is designed to meet the “everyday needs” of citizens, enabling them to participate in the digital economy by paying for international services, subscriptions, and goods with ease. This “digitally empowered” approach ensures that even small-scale entrepreneurs and remote users can compete on a global stage.

Beyond mere convenience, the rollout of the MoMo Virtual Card is a significant driver of economic growth and financial inclusion. By providing a secure, prepaid method for online transactions, UBA and MTN are fostering a safer digital environment that protects users from fraud while promoting a cashless society. This launch is not just a product update; it is a foundational step in MTN’s “Ambition 2025” and UBA’s mission to lead financial innovation throughout Zambia.
